We compared two Professional market GPUs: 4GB VRAM Quadro M4000M and 256MB VRAM Quadro NVS 130M to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A Quadro M4000M 's Advantages
Released 8 years and 3 months late
Larger VRAM bandwidth (160.4GB/s vs 11.20GB/s)
1272 additional rendering cores
NVIDIA Quadro NVS 130M 's Advantages
Lower TDP (10W vs 100W)
